Toni “TJ” Janelle Ray

Toni “TJ” Janelle Ray, 40, passed away March 31, 2025. She was born on February 24, 1985 to Lena Ray at Bothwell Hospital in Sedalia, Missouri.

Toni was a happy and easy baby to care for. As a toddler, one of her favorite possessions was a purse she took everywhere with her. When she took it to her grandparents’ house, she always came home with a purse full of items collected. Items such as the TV remote, grandma’s work badge, money, hairbrush and anything else she could get her hands on. Her mom made regular trips from their home in Sedalia back to Butler to return the items to her grandmother. One of her grandparents’ favorite stories about Toni was the day there were bringing her home and got a flat tire. Toni was in the car seat dancing to bumping of the tire.

She loved school, reading, drawing and dancing with her friends. She took God as her Savior and was baptized at the age of 14. She was outgoing, talkative, bubbly and quick to make friends. Adulthood was a struggle of addiction for her. But she loved her family and children, and they will all cherish the wonderful memories they have of her.

Toni was preceded in death by her grandparents Janice Ray, Wallace Ray (Dobie), and uncle and namesake Tony Ray.

She leaves behind to cherish her memory mother Lena Ray; brother Teron Ray (Veronica); children Jerzie, Jaizlyn, and Janelle Ray and Brayden Schull; niece Ka’Lia Ray; uncles Wally Ray (Donna) and Pat Ray (Shelli); aunt Sherry Recob; great aunts Nellie Salterfield (Terry), Lorraine Wilkinson, and Rhonda Warren; great uncles Rodney, Floyd and Waymon Young (Linda); her bonus sisters and brothers along with a host of cousins and friends.

Visitation will be 10am, followed by a Celebration of Life at 11am, Friday, April 11, 2025, at Heartland Cremation and Burial Society, 6113 Blue Ridge Blvd, Raytown, Missouri 64133.
